Author: | Go_Hard_Race_Team [ Thu Mar 31, 2005 13:16:27 ] |
Post subject: | low ratio pulley set |
Hi guys I currently have 2 xrays on the way, an FK and the T1R They are comming with a low ratio pulley set and i am wanting to know what would i stand to gain from using the low ratio option ? Im sure this would have been discussed elsewhere but do you think i can find it ![]() Thanks for any and all help. Cheers Michael |
Author: | Tonyv [ Thu Mar 31, 2005 15:19:29 ] |
Post subject: | |
Michael: The low internal ratio is more efficiƫnt. This frees up the drive train reducing drag. Added benefit is that you will have slightly more runtime. |
